Transaction 6ff91c79dd462183d3303c52cb4bf3f21c88ab36beffa07cf757eccfa0b83dae
1 Input
1 Output
-
6ff91c79dd462183d3303c52cb4bf3f21c88ab36beffa07cf757eccfa0b83dae:0
- value
- 18656
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d6b1d19ac5fc07a6e0b2cd04b17ccf524ec6cca
- address
- bc1q34436xdvtlq85mst9ngyk97v75jwcmx2jdhrxu